Padlocks and Keys on some main menu items

Have you ever wondered why some of the main menu items (like folders) are just folders and some have a key and some have a padlock....well, here is a quick explanation.

  Any folder in the main navigator (or sub folders in the folder structure) that have a simple folder icon are 'open' (unrestricted) so all GVO users can see and access them.

Any folder that has a 'key' icon by the title is a 'restricted' folder - only people who have been granted access or the GVO Managers can see the folder and the contents. Managers can see everything in the GVO with the exception of Rooms (see below) where they are not members. Restrictions to folders can be set by the local GVO Manager or any user that has the access level that allows folder creation.

An item with a 'padlock' icon is a 'Room' which is a more secure area of the GVO often used for activity such as Pay Panel, HT Appraisal, HT Recruitment - only people who have been given access to the Room can see and enter the room. A Room is like a mini secure GVO. Even GVO Managers cannot access a Room if they are not a Room Member. Rooms are set up by the GVO Support Team and there are no limits on the number of Rooms in a GVO.
